Well, let me start by saying that I'm sorry that it's been so long since my last post. Getting a project like this off the ground can be a very time consuming and slow moving process. Fortunately, if you put all the pieces together correctly, things smooth out and speed up quickly.
Of course, the big question has been, "Is the toolset coming to Mac?" We have had a developer looking at the toolset code. Porting the toolset to Mac will be a much bigger undertaking than we had hoped and cost more than we had anticipated. That being said, I can tell you that we still intend to bring the toolset to Mac. I am trying to finalize budget approvals and the development contract, but work is already well under way with the port. (A big thanks to our developer for their willingness to get to work on this right away.) Given the complexity of the project, it will likely take longer than we had initially anticipated. There is still the slight possibility of a major roadblock preventing the toolset port, but I'm confident that won't happen.
Several people in our office have been playing NWN and working with the toolset, and I've got to say that we are more excited than ever to bring this title to Mac users.
I'll try to monitor the forums a bit this week and would be happy to answer any of your questions.

In regard to the questions about cross-platform play and design-Yes, the Mac version will play with the PC version and all items designed with the Mac toolset will work with the PC version.
I am still being a bit cautious with toolset announcements. Not because there is any one thing that seems to be a problem but because it is such a complex piece of software. There's always a chance that some insurmountable hurdle will pop up. However, such instances are rare and we don't see any giant red flags flying right now. If you haven't seen the toolset, let me tell you that it is a FANTASTIC piece of work.
